diff options
Diffstat (limited to 'src')
| -rw-r--r-- | src/App.vue | 5 | ||||
| -rw-r--r-- | src/components/modal/modal.vue | 18 |
2 files changed, 9 insertions, 14 deletions
diff --git a/src/App.vue b/src/App.vue index a53bcb97..dbe842ec 100644 --- a/src/App.vue +++ b/src/App.vue @@ -120,10 +120,7 @@ <MobilePostStatusButton /> <UserReportingModal /> <PostStatusModal /> - <portal-target - name="modal" - multiple - /> + <portal-target name="modal" /> </div> </template> diff --git a/src/components/modal/modal.vue b/src/components/modal/modal.vue index d4fe9f76..51f35262 100644 --- a/src/components/modal/modal.vue +++ b/src/components/modal/modal.vue @@ -1,14 +1,12 @@ <template> - <portal to="modal"> - <div - v-show="isOpen" - v-body-scroll-lock="isOpen" - :class="['modal-view', viewClass]" - @click.self="closeModal" - > - <slot /> - </div> - </portal> + <div + v-show="isOpen" + v-body-scroll-lock="isOpen" + :class="['modal-view', viewClass]" + @click.self="closeModal" + > + <slot /> + </div> </template> <script src="./modal.js"></script> |
